What you will be doing:

 

  • Month/Quarter/Year End Closing: Ensure accurate financial reporting through system reconciliation, journal entry posting, and analysis for proper accruals. Resolve purchase and sales price discrepancies, prepare income statements, and report accruals to the YII Finance Manager monthly. Generate cost center reports, review with managers, and meet monthly and quarterly reporting deadlines.
  • Forecasting: Support YII in short-term forecasting, including preparing cost center operating expense forecasts and consolidating forecasts for review with YII managers. Assist in the consolidation of monthly rolling forecast updates and prepare direct profit forecasts, factoring in elements like copper price, labor rate changes, customer productivity, potential new business, and value management activity. Additionally, handling logistics and extraordinary expense forecasts, considering factors such as new program launches, balance-outs, and historical trends. Responsible for preparing program direct costs, including labor and other program-specific operating expenses, and updating forecasts as required by management.
  • Commercial: Collaborate with the Sales group to facilitate customer initiatives, including negotiating and implementing new cost models. Conduct detailed analysis at the Program and part level for Direct Profit assessment and implement improvement actions. Analyze and summarize variances in affiliate quotes compared to expected factory cost forecasts, lead efforts to resolve discrepancies. Ensure timely billing of all new customer purchase orders in accordance with GAAP.
  • Cash Flow: Manage YII cashflow, payments to vendors and payments in from customers, and prepare cashflow reporting to YIC.
